Carbon monoxide alarms sound in residence near Cornstalk DrBear DE

audio iconFire & Arson
Cornstalk Dr, Bear, DE 19720

Multiple carbon monoxide alarms are sounding inside a residence near Cornstalk Drive. Elevated carbon monoxide levels were confirmed in the kitchen, basement, and a second-floor bedroom. Occupants are present, and the source may be related to cooking. Emergency responders are investigating the situation.
